# Component Sourcing Automation

*/Opportunities/Component_Sourcing_Automation*

## Opportunity Overview

**Wedge**: Target alternate sourcing for passive components and discrete semiconductors within printed circuit board assembly prototyping shops. These components possess standardized, highly structured parameters, enabling fast proof of accuracy without risking system-level redesigns. From this beachhead, expand into matching complex active components and directly executing supplier RFQs.
**Timing**: Multimodal LLMs extract electrical parameters, pinouts, and thermal tolerances directly from unstructured manufacturer PDFs, automating comparisons that previously required human engineering judgment. Major component distributors now expose live-inventory APIs that these models query to confirm real-time availability.
**Why This I C P**: Mid-market electronics manufacturers handle high-mix production runs with frequent BOM updates, but lack the dedicated procurement armies and prioritized supplier allocations of Tier-1 device makers.
**Size Of Prize**: There are approximately 30,000 mid-market hardware OEMs and electronics manufacturing providers in the US and Europe. At an average annual spend of $40,000 to replace the fractional labor of buyers dedicated to alternate component matching, the addressable market is $1.2B.
**Gap Narrative**: Hardware procurement teams manually cross-reference unstructured PDF datasheets against distributor APIs to find alternate parts for out-of-stock components. Existing tools track inventory but do not actively read electrical parameters to suggest and verify drop-in replacements.
**Defensibility**: The system builds defensibility through a proprietary component-equivalence graph. Each accepted drop-in replacement logs a deterministic edge in the database, reducing reliance on continuous LLM parsing and creating a proprietary data asset that competitors cannot replicate from public sources alone.
**Why This Thesis**: An Agentic approach resolves the unstructured search and matching bottleneck directly. Instead of providing a static database interface, the agent ingests a raw Bill of Materials, identifies at-risk components, and autonomously outputs a finalized list of verified alternates with live purchase links.

## Opportunity Build Profile

**Hardest Part**: Achieving near-perfect accuracy when matching loosely typed internal part numbers from messy spreadsheets to exact, orderable manufacturer part numbers across fragmented distributor catalogs.
**Min Viable Scope**: A BOM-scrubbing web app strictly for passive electronic components querying only the top three global distributors. Leave out complex active components, custom mechanical parts, and automated purchasing or enterprise ERP writeback.
**Cold Start Problem**: The engine lacks proprietary cross-reference data for safe alternative parts until users interact with it. Bootstrap by layering the tool over standard aggregator APIs and capturing human-approved substitutions to build a proprietary mapping graph.
**Time To First Value**: 10 minutes; gating step is uploading an initial CSV BOM and waiting for the first batch of supplier API returns.
